GolfWRX: Denny McCarthy’s WITB for August 2024

News RoomBy News RoomAugust 27, 2024Updated:August 27, 20243 Mins Read
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

Denny McCarthy is a professional golfer whose club choices are detailed in his bag as of the Wyndham Championship. His bag includes a Titleist GT2 driver with a Mitsubishi Diamana BB 63 TX shaft. He also carries a TaylorMade Qi10 3-wood with a Mitsubishi Diamana BB 73 TX shaft, as well as another TaylorMade Qi10 3-wood with a Graphite Design Tour AD DI 8 X shaft. McCarthy also has a TaylorMade Qi10 5-wood with a Mitsubishi Diamana BB 83 TX shaft.

In terms of irons, McCarthy uses a combination of Titleist T200, Srixon ZX U Mk II, Titleist T100, and Callaway Apex TCB clubs. The shafts in his irons are True Temper Dynamic Gold Tour Issue 120 for the 4-6 irons and True Temper Dynamic Gold Tour Issue Mid for the 6-9 irons. McCarthy’s wedges include Titleist Vokey Design SM10 wedges in 48-10F and 52-12F lofts, as well as a 56-08M wedge. He also carries a WedgeWorks Proto 60-L wedge. The shafts in his wedges are True Temper AMT Tour White X100 and True Temper Dynamic Gold Tour Issue S400.

McCarthy’s putter is a Scotty Cameron GoLo with a Scotty Cameron grip. He uses Golf Pride Tour Velvet grips for all his clubs. When it comes to golf balls, McCarthy plays with Titleist Pro V1 balls.
